URL('default', 'user', args='login', host=True, scheme=True) alone will 
produce http://yourdomain.com/yourapp/default/user/login, so there should 
be no need to add "/%s/default/user/login" % request.application, which 
will result 
in http://yourdomain.com/yourapp/default/user/login/yourapp/default/user/login. 
That will still work (the second /yourapp/default/user/login will just be 
interpreted as a set of request.args and ignored by web2py), but no need 
for it.
